Interest Rates and Common Fees (what to expect)
Your final APR depends on your credit profile and may vary from the advertised rate.
Standard balance transfer fees are typically 3.99% when you move a balance to an existing Tesco Bank card.
Standard money transfer fees to an existing account are often 3.99%.
On balance-transfer-focused products, purchases are shown at 24.9% p.a. (variable) in the representative example.
Tip: Always read the “representative example” box on the specific product page you plan to choose; it shows the APR, assumed credit limit, and purchase rate used for the typical example.

How to Apply for Tesco Bank Credit Cards
Decide whether you want promotional 0% periods (e.g., balance transfers for 18 months with a low 0.99% fee) or a simple low rate.
Run the eligibility check
Use Tesco Bank’s Eligibility Checker to see your likelihood of approval without impacting your credit score.
Gather your address history (last three years), annual income, monthly take-home pay, and rent/mortgage details.
Apply online
If results look good, proceed to the online application. Tesco Bank indicates you can complete this process in about 10 minutes for some products.
Have your ID information ready and ensure your credit file is accurate.
If approved, set up the account
Activate your card, add it to your mobile wallet if you use one, set up Direct Debit for at least the minimum payment, and register for online banking.
Product pages and help sections guide you through activation and account setup.
Add the Tesco Bank credit card to Apple Pay for smoother transactions.
Manage your promotional periods carefully
Track when your 0% periods end, and plan repayments or transfers before the expiry to avoid reverting to the standard variable purchase/transfer rates and fees.

Choose the Right Tesco Bank Credit Card
Pick the card type that matches your single biggest need (BT savings, 0% purchases time, low ongoing APR, or credit build).
Confirm you can finish within the promo (if applicable) using a fixed monthly payment.
Lock in Direct Debit + alerts to protect the rate and your credit file.
Card | Rep. APR (variable) | 0% on Purchases | 0% on Balance Transfers | Money Transfers | Notes / Typical Use |
---|---|---|---|---|---|
Low Fee Balance Transfer Credit Card | 24.9% | — | 18 months from account opening, 0.99% fee | 0% for 9 months, 3.99% fee | Best if you want a low-fee 0% BT period and can repay before promo ends. |
Balance Transfer & Purchases Credit Card (All-round) | 24.9% | 0% for 20 months from account opening | 0% for 20 months, 2.99% fee (complete within 90 days) | — | Balanced option if you need both 0% on new spending and transfers. |
Low APR Credit Card | 10.9% | — | — | — | Simple low ongoing rate for everyday use; good if you don’t need intro promos. |
Foundation Credit Card (credit build) | 29.9% | — | — | — | Aimed at building/improving credit; starting limits £200–£1,500 plus access to CreditView. |
Do you already have debt elsewhere at a higher APR?
Yes → Prioritise a Balance Transfer card (low fee + long 0% window).
Will you need time to pay for new purchases?
Yes → Look at an All-Round card (0% on purchases and balance transfers).
Do you mainly pay in full and want a predictable low rate just in case?
Yes → Consider Low APR.
Is your credit thin or recovering?
Yes → Consider Foundation (credit-builder).
